Pars United agree Dunfermline takeover

With the CVA now agreed, thanks to achieving the support of 75 per cent of creditors, the Scottish League One club avoid a £150,000 bond requirement and a 10-point deduction from the Scottish Football Association.

Gavin Masterton, the club's former owner, was a notable absentee from the CVA vote, giving up the money owed to him by the club, which is thought to be around £8.5million.
